|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ectnet.rim.device.api.util.EmptyEnumeration
public final class EmptyEnumeration
Permits handling of empty enumerations.
This wrapper around the Enumeration interface handles returning of empty enumerations when no elements exist to be retrieved. This ensures that the invoker does not have to check for null but can rather rely on simply using the enumeration interface.
Constructor Summary | ||
---|---|---|
EmptyEnumeration()
Constructs a new EmptyEnumeration object. |
Method Summary | ||
---|---|---|
boolean |
hasMoreElements()
Determines if this enumeration has more objects. |
|
Object |
nextElement()
Retrieves the next element in this enumeration.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public EmptyEnumeration()
By default, this constructor does nothing.
Method Detail |
---|
public boolean hasMoreElements()
hasMoreElements
in interface Enumeration
public Object nextElement() throws NoSuchElementException
nextElement
in interface Enumeration
NoSuchElementException
- Always by default, since this is an empty
enumeration.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Copyright 1999-2011 Research In Motion Limited. 295 Phillip Street, Waterloo, Ontario, Canada, N2L 3W8. All Rights Reserved.
Java is a trademark of Oracle America Inc. in the US and other countries.
Legal